Hi Jeffrey, We haven't tested that model. It seems to be supported by OpenWrt ( http://wiki.openwrt.org/toh/start#linksys). *.bin images have a header which is model and version specific, so I expect that this won't work. You might have better luck with the generic trx broadcom image listed at the website, but this is NOT tested and you might end up with a broken device. The safest way would be to compile the image yourself, instructions are listed at the Pantou website.
